The SICK BAY

Services started 102years when the school started, but has been changing places.
This current building was constructed through the United States of America AID programme
for the people of Uganda.
This department caters for the good health of students and staff. Sick students are admitted.
There are 3 beds for girls and 7 for boys. Blood tests are carried out and emergency cases
are referred to hospital.

The sick bay has the following facilities;
BP. Machine, sterilizer, stretcher, wheel chair, refrigerator, nebulizer

Over the years King's College Budo, true to its founders' vision, has recognised excellent performance in different fields; games and sports, agriculture, academics, being helpful, music and drama, debate, etc.

This recognition culminates in our cherished annual prize giving ceremonies. We have gone a step further by recognising excellent contribution by our former students, by awarding them the prestigious Budo ORDER OF MERIT.”
 
King's College Budo's vision is “To be the hub for the best informed global co-education with a christian influence” and our mission is “to provide quality education through networking & teamwork in order to address global trends ”
 
At Budo we aim at teaching our students the root values of integrity, honesty, niceness & hard work other than the fruit values of power, prestige & prosperity. "Headmaster
